HP OmniDesk is a gaming computer with Windows 11 Pro released in 2026. It has an excellent Intel processor and enough memory for its price. The computer has the GeForce RTX 5060 video card that is not the best for playing games. You can play 80% of the games published this year on recommended settings.

Processor: Intel Core Ultra 7 265 Processor (20 Cores, 20 Threads, 30MB L3 Cache, Base Frequency at 1.8 GHz, Up to 5.3 GHz Turbo Frequency)
Graphics: NVIDIA GeForce RTX 5060
Chassis&Power supply:400 W 80 Plus Platinum certified power supply
